Among the most capable options in this category, the core advantages are clear: a turbocharged or turbo-diesel engine that produces strong torque at low rpm, a drivetrain designed to handle sustained high load with minimal heat buildup, and a chassis that keeps the truck steady while the heavy trailer pulls. A high-torque diesel powerplant, paired with a heavy-duty automatic transmission and a carefully chosen axle ratio, creates the foundation for impressive towing performance. The axle ratio matters because it defines how aggressively the engine’s torque is multiplied at the wheels, translating to either quicker launch or more steady pulling at highway speeds. In addition, the availability of a factory-installed trailer brake controller and an integrated sway control system helps keep the entire combination on an even keel when braking is required without warning, or when a gust shifts the trailer’s direction mid-stroke.

But power and stability alone don’t tell the full story. Real strength in heavy towing also comes from the vehicle’s ability to manage weight and distribution. The payload capacity of the truck, the weight of the trailer tongue, and the towing configuration all interact in complex ways. A truck that can haul a heavy load with a generous payload rating is better prepared to handle occasional miscalculations along the way, such as a fuller fuel tank or extra cargo in the bed, which shift weight toward the front axle and improve overall balance. Conversely, a truck with limited payload capacity may feel overburdened, causing the rear suspension to sag and the trailer to wag more readily at modest changes in speed or direction. From a decision-making perspective, the key considerations move beyond the peak numbers and into the realm of configuration and capability alignment. The right engine type matters more than the badge on the tailgate. A high-torque turbo-diesel or a similarly torquey powerplant will typically offer the strongest low-end pulling force and consistent power through steep grades. The transmission must be robust enough to handle repeated, heavy-duty shifts without overheating. An aggressive axle ratio helps maintain momentum on climbs, while a carefully engineered towing package ensures that the necessary braking, sway control, and hitch support are not add-ons but integrated features designed to work in harmony with the vehicle’s fundamental powertrain and chassis architecture. The behavior of the brakes—especially when the trailer is demanding extra stopping power—becomes a critical safety metric. And because the legal landscape for towing varies by region, it is essential to understand not only the vehicle’s raw capability but also the limits imposed by road rules, trailer brakes, and mass restrictions. In some regions, legal limits on the combined weight of tow vehicle plus trailer can be quite conservative, underscoring why prudent planning and accurate weight measurements are indispensable for any heavy-tow operation.

For readers seeking practical steps, consider how your typical loads align with the system’s strengths. Start with a realistic trailer weight and calculate your tongue and payload. Examine the towing package contents: a trailer brake controller, sway control, and a hitch system that preserves weight distribution. Confirm the axle ratio suits your expected speeds and gradients. Inspect cooling systems, transmission heat management, and the availability of driver-assist features that contribute to trailer control. Above all, test the complete package in conditions that mirror your normal use—gradients, wind, and traffic so you can experience how the truck will feel when it truly matters. Powertrain options matter in nuanced ways for family towing. A gasoline or turbocharged V6/V8 combination can deliver robust torque for confident, steady acceleration with a trailer in tow, while diesel variants typically emphasize low-end torque and sustained pulling power for sustained highway overtures. For families, the choice often leans toward engines that deliver steady, predictable performance rather than peak numbers alone. The presence of a well-calibrated transmission, especially a multi-speed automatic designed to optimize torque at low revs, can maintain smoothness when starting from a stop with a trailer or negotiating a hilly route to a lakeside camp. Axle ratios and gearing play their part behind the scenes, shaping how readily the truck maintains speed with a heavy load and how efficiently it handles the torque curve. The best family options present this power in a way that doesn’t demand constant micromanagement from the driver, leaving more focus for the passenger cabin and the road ahead.
